Up-cast this base property to an ArrayProperty, if such an upcast is valid. This can be checked with the isArray() function. If the upcast is not valid, an empty pointer will be returned. This default implementation returns an empty pointer.
|
virtual |
Up-cast this base property to a CompoundProperty, if such an upcast is valid. This can be checked with the isCompound() function. If the upcast is not valid, an empty pointer will be returned. This default implementation returns an empty pointer.
|
virtual |
Up-cast this base property to a ScalarProperty, if such an upcast is valid. This can be checked with the isScalar() function. If the upcast is not valid, an empty pointer will be returned. This default implementation returns an empty pointer.

Non-compound properties have a DataType. It is an error to call this function for CompoundProperties, and an exception will be thrown. This is a convenience function which just returns the DataType from the header that was used in creation.

Properties are created with a collection of metadata that is stored in a lightweight structure called PropertyHeader. This returns a constant reference to the PropertyHeader which was given upon creation.

All properties have a name, which is unique amongst its siblings in the compund property they all live in. This is the name that was given when the property was created, and is part of the property header.

All properties have an object that owns them, and in order to ensure the object stays alive as long as the properties do, they retain a shared pointer to their object.

Most properties live in a compound property. (Except for the top-compound property in any object) This returns a pointer to the parent compound property.

There are three types of abstract properties. They are Scalar, Array, and Compound properties. This function returns an enum PropertyType which indicates which property type is returned. This is simply a convenience function which returns data from the PropertyHeader.

Non-compound properties have a TimeSampling. It is an error to call this function for CompoundProperties, and an exception will be thrown. This is a convenience function which just returns the TimeSampling from the header that was used in creation.
